在科技飞速发展的今天,人机交互(Human-Machine Interface,简称HMI)设计已经成为产品设计中的关键环节。HMI设计的好坏直接影响用户体验和产品的市场竞争力。本文将探讨HMI设计的发展趋势,并提供一些实用的技巧,帮助设计师把握未来。
一、HMI设计的发展趋势
1. 智能化
随着人工智能技术的不断发展,智能化成为HMI设计的重要趋势。通过智能算法,HMI能够更好地理解用户需求,提供更加个性化的交互体验。例如,智能语音助手、手势识别、眼动追踪等技术在HMI设计中的应用越来越广泛。
2. 个性化
用户对产品的需求日益多样化,个性化成为HMI设计的关键。设计师需要根据不同用户群体的特点,设计出符合他们需求的交互界面。这要求设计师在了解用户需求的基础上,进行深入的市场调研和用户分析。
3. 跨平台融合
随着移动设备的普及,跨平台融合成为HMI设计的新趋势。设计师需要考虑如何在不同的平台(如手机、平板、电脑等)上提供一致的用户体验。这要求设计师具备跨平台的设计能力,并关注不同平台的设计规范。
4. 高度集成
HMI设计正朝着高度集成的方向发展。这意味着,设计师需要将多个功能模块整合到一个界面中,使用户体验更加流畅。例如,将导航、搜索、分享等功能集成到同一个界面,减少用户操作步骤。
5. 用户体验至上
随着市场竞争的加剧,用户体验成为HMI设计的重要考量因素。设计师需要关注用户的痛点,通过优化界面布局、简化操作流程、提升视觉效果等方式,提高用户体验。
二、HMI设计的实用技巧
1. 简洁明了
简洁明了的界面设计有助于用户快速理解和使用产品。设计师应遵循“少即是多”的原则,避免界面过于复杂。
2. 一致性
一致性是HMI设计的关键。设计师应确保界面元素、颜色、字体等在各个页面保持一致,以提高用户体验。
3. 交互反馈
良好的交互反馈有助于用户了解自己的操作结果。设计师应通过视觉、听觉、触觉等方式,为用户提供及时的反馈。
4. 考虑用户习惯
设计师在HMI设计过程中,应充分考虑用户的操作习惯,使产品更加易于上手。
5. 持续优化
HMI设计是一个持续优化的过程。设计师应关注用户反馈,不断调整和改进设计。
6. 代码实现
以下是一个简单的HMI设计代码示例,使用HTML和CSS实现一个登录界面:
<!DOCTYPE html>
<html>
<head>
<title>登录界面</title>
<style>
body {
font-family: Arial, sans-serif;
}
.login-container {
width: 300px;
margin: 100px auto;
padding: 20px;
border: 1px solid #ccc;
border-radius: 5px;
}
input[type="text"], input[type="password"] {
width: 100%;
padding: 10px;
margin: 10px 0;
border: 1px solid #ccc;
border-radius: 5px;
}
input[type="submit"] {
width: 100%;
padding: 10px;
background-color: #4CAF50;
color: white;
border: none;
border-radius: 5px;
cursor: pointer;
}
</style>
</head>
<body>
<div class="login-container">
<input type="text" placeholder="用户名" />
<input type="password" placeholder="密码" />
<input type="submit" value="登录" />
</div>
</body>
</html>
通过以上示例,我们可以看到HMI设计在代码实现方面的简洁性和实用性。
总之,HMI设计是产品设计中不可或缺的一环。设计师应紧跟HMI设计的发展趋势,掌握实用技巧,为用户提供更好的交互体验。